我安装了Visual Studio 2012和DevExpress 13.1。当Visual Studio启动时,它生成了一个如图所示的错误,
“Microsoft.VisualStudio.Editor.Implementation。EditorPackage的包没有正确加载。
该问题可能是由配置更改或安装了另一个扩展程序引起的。您可以通过检查文件“C:\Users\must\AppData\Roaming\Microsoft\VisualStudio\11.0\ActivityLog.xml”来获得更多信息。
继续显示此错误消息?
此错误也出现在Visual Studio 2017中。
这些方法对我都没用。重新安装Visual Studio 2022后,从开始菜单打开时没有任何错误。然而,当从命令提示符启动时,我得到2个'package未正确加载'错误(IntelliCodeCppPackage, Global Hub Client package), IDE自动关闭。原来,在我的情况下,根本原因是在cmd中使用了缩短的文件路径。
我是这样写的:
set MS_DEV=C:\PROGRA~1\MIB055~1\2022\Preview
call %MS_DEV%\VC\Auxiliary\Build\vcvars64.bat
call %MS_DEV%\Common7\IDE\devenv.exe
更改缩短路径将全路径加载的包正确为我
set MS_DEV="C:\Program Files\Microsoft Visual Studio\2022\Preview"
缩短的路径用于Visual Studio 2017,不确定2022年有什么变化。
首先,你需要确保有最新的微软。net框架版本,在我的情况下,我有4.6版本,我已经下载并更新了。net框架4.8.03761开发者包,从官方网站:
https://dotnet.microsoft.com/download/dotnet-framework/net48
一旦我重启我的电脑,继续修复,我解决了这个问题,清除Visual Studio组件模型缓存。
只需删除或重命名此文件夹:
微软% LocalAppData % \ \ VisualStudio \ \ ComponentModelCache 11级左右
或
% LocalAppData % \ Microsoft \ VPDExpress \ 11.0 \ ComponentModelCache
并重新启动Visual Studio。
尝试使用管理权限在Visual Studio命令提示符上使用devenv /setup。
我在Visual Studio 2013 Ultimate中也遇到了同样的问题。我尝试了Reza在这里发布的解决方案,但它不起作用。
最终我无法关闭Visual Studio。当我试图关闭时,它显示了一个类似的对话框,但它并没有关闭。我尝试了这个:错误消息“没有找到匹配约束合同名称的导出”。既不。
我注意到团队资源管理器窗口中有一条消息说“无法找到Page 'somenumber'”。我尝试了这种方法,我找到了这个答案:使用Visual Studio 2012找不到页面“312e8a59-2712-48a1-863e-0ef4e67961fc”。因此,我在Visual Studio命令提示符中以管理权限运行devenv /setup。
它成功了,现在一切都好了。